Subject: Default time for reports with "date time" option should have "date from" = 00.00 "date to" = 23.99
Summary:    

Default time for reports with date time option should be date from = 00.00 date to = 23.99 

This does need to be done in Link, Web Reports.

Development work for this case has been completed.
The change will be available in version: 9.4

1. The following changes were made(Include Database object names, Program classes and any other relevant information):|

  1. Default Link Reporter and Web Reporter "time From" to  "Today 12 AM"
  2. Default Link Reporter and Web Reporter "time to" to  "Today 11:59 PM"
